    Honestly this has to be one of the best recycling facilities I've ever been to. It's pretty self…read moreexplanatory as far as coming in to drop off all of your recyclables. It's very organized and they do have staff on site to guide or assist you. They have everything sorted by paper, glass (brown, green, and clear), plastic, tin and aluminum cans, cardboard, and even a spot for lawn waste (lawn clippings, leaves, branches) It's not too confusing, very self explanatory once you drive in, it's a small area though and if it's you're first time it is hard to find, you have to really pay attention. I love coming here to drop off my recyclables, I just wish they had more and longer hours, they're open Wednesday 4p-7p and Saturday 9a-2p, but overall I have a good experience here, just drop and go really.
